My chevy mechanic friend says that I might be running into trouble with my disc brake swap. I got the rear disks from an 86 turbo 2 door? Sedan? two wheel drive. I am going to be putting them into my 83 gl 2 wheel drive. Does the Master cylinder have a different outlet for the rear discs and the rear drums? Will the flow be enough? Too much? I dont really understand the problems that could arise but he felt that it might be trouble installing them. But then again he told me not to buy the car! :rolleyes:

 

So anyways I know lots of you folks have done swaps and it works well. But this is an ea82 rear disc going into an ea81 car. I practiced the swap in the boneyard and it looked like it would work (plumbing is a little off and I did grab the hard hose from the original disc-having car) I think I might have to drill a hole through the a arm? the suspension swinging thing =P to get the line from the caliper to the hose running up the car. Or I need to bend it but I dont want to do that I dont think. ::shrug::

 

Advice beyond the directions already in the subaru manual on the board?

Ive done it on 3 of my 4WD Subaru's. All of them were EA81 body styles. It is a direct bolt on. There is nothing special that needs to be modified or removed.

Brian, all vehicles have a proportioning valve from the factory. They equalize the bias and weight of the vehicle from front to rear in regards to braking. They are designed and adjusted from the factory to work with the particular vehicle on which they are installed. It would make sense that a wagon would have a different setting due to its heavier weight in back than a Brat with very little weight in the rear. Likewise rear disks have more clamping/braking power than drum brakes and would likely need a proportioning valve to accomadate that difference. Also, calipers and wheel cylinders have different requirements for volume and pressure when it comes to fluid.

 

I'm not trying to say rear disks don't work on Subs, they obviously do. However, It doesn't work that way on any other vehicle without at least an adjustable proportioning valve from Summit to compensate for the increased braking from the rear.

I just check my FSM, it dosn't show a proportioning valve anywhere in the brake system. Another thing that everyone needs to keep in mind is that the brake circuits are not split front and rear. The split is Left front Right rear and Right front left rear.

How about if I prove you right! The master cyl's are the same 85-94 in the NAPA listings, and I checked with my local dealer and the proportioning valve is the same for disc and drum (at least in 1988, the year I asked about). The master cylinder is different 84 and older - both bores are 13/16" versus one 13/16" and one 1" in the later models, so that might cause a problem when you cross years, but obviously it isn't much of a problem with all the case histories on this board!
